1. A person blows his breath into a straw that is placed
in limewater. The lime water becomes cloudy
because the persons breath contains carbon
dioxide
2. An unknown gas is more dense than air, doesn’t
support combustion, and turns a limewater solution
cloudy. This gas is most probably carbon dioxide.
3. Human testes produce spermatozoa.
4. If the medulla of the brain of a human was damaged,
which of these conditions would most likely result?
Difficulty in breathing
5. IN diagnostic testing, the electroencephalogram
permits the physician to examine the impulses of
the nerve cells within the brain
6. In ecological succession, the first living thing to
colonize a hitherto barren area is called a pioneer
organism
7. Night blindness by humans is caused by a lack of
Vitamin A
8. To sterilize a metal probe in the office, a dentist could
use a steam sterilizer. If unavailable, the most
effective method to sterilize the instrument would be
boiling it in water for 15 minutes
9. The organ that filters metabolic wastes from the
blood is the kidney
10. The process of nuclear cell division in the cell
reproduction of plants differs from mammals. A major
difference is that cell plates are synthesized
11. Unicellular organisms have a nucleus and can
swim with the aid of cilia are examples of
protozoans
